The development of the Mid-Atlantic Advanced Manufacturing Center has been a high priority of Greensville County and the Regional Industrial Facilities Authority members. The provision of utilities is a key component of the development plan.

One utility that weighs heavily in a project locator’s decision is the availability of natural gas. Natural Gas can greatly reduce operational costs to a company.

The recent announcement of the Atlantic Coast Pipeline by Dominion and the Commonwealth of Virginia reported the new natural gas line will be within 5 miles or less of the MAMaC property. This close proximity and natural gas capacity is a benefit for the MAMaC project as well as future economic development in the community.
